Welcome to the Pipeline team! One thing that trips up newcomers: our message queue, Quillstream, runs log compaction nightly, so old records with the same key get squashed down to the latest value. Don't expect full history after 24 hours. If you need replayable history, use the archive topics instead. The full compaction config and tuning notes live on our internal wiki page.

wiki page, yaguf-bawig: https://jira.norvacorp.internal/browse/display/view/b5a061abb09d

- [ ] Step 7: Archive cold storage buckets (Glacierline tier). Confirm both ceremony witnesses are present, verify bucket manifests match the Oxbow ledger, then seal the archive key shares. Plugin authors may observe but not handle shares. Once sealed, the archive index itself is encrypted and can only be reopened with the passphrase below.

vault phrase of badup-hahig = tamael-aldael-kelmir-istael-fenok-istwyn-tamius-jorath-oliion

Handover: Gradewell GPU profiler

Hey Priya — handing off the Gradewell memory profiler before I'm out. Security-wise, the main thing to eyeball is the sampling agent: it reads device memory maps with elevated privileges, and the capture endpoint is only gated by a shared token right now. Nothing exfiltrates off-host by default. The agent on the profiling fleet currently runs with the following settings.

deployment values, kajep-kageg:
[praix]
host = praix.paliqcorp.corp
user = praix_svc
database = praix_prod